noun
1.A device used for draining things.
‘There are people who say that the drainers are simply moving the problem from their property to someone else’s property.’
‘During my early childhood, a brick boiler, or ` copper ’ as it was called stood in the corner next to the drainer.’
2.A draining board.
‘There is an open fireplace with back boiler and the Belfast sink has a tiled drainer.’
‘The utility room features a slate floor, stainless steel sink unit and single drainer.’
3.A person who drains a flooded area.
‘There are people who say that the drainers are simply moving the problem from their property to someone else’s property.’
‘From drainer to entertainer, he lifts the lid on the toilet seat of Show Biz!’
4.A rack placed on a draining board to hold crockery and cutlery while it drains.
‘Tim stacked dishes in the drainer and stared at the phone.’
‘Richard picked up a dish out of the drainer and began to dry it.’
